How to survive the flight to Piasa?
If you're not prepared, traveling can be challenging. But there's no need to worry. Follow these useful tips for a worry-free start to your time in Piasa.What to pack in your hand luggage:

  • The trick to having a stress-free flight experience is to pack in advance. Start with the essentials: passport, travel docs, cash and daily medications. Next, bring items that'll help keep you busy, like your laptop or a good book. It's also smart to bring your chargers, a neck pillow and a pair of headphones. Finally, don't forget to pop in toiletry items like a toothbrush, facial wipes and a fresh change of clothes.

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Make sure you don't have a Swiss Army knife hiding in your hand luggage. Other prohibited items include flammable or explosive goods, such as fuel and fireworks, and liquids and gels in containers with a volume of more than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ters).

What to wear on a flight:

  • The key to a comfortable flight can be as simple as your choice of clothing. Prepare for temperature changes by layering up. That way you'll stay nice and warm if the cabin begins to cool down. Shoes like stilettos, flip flops and lace-up boots are best left in your checked suitcase. Instead, go for flat, closed-toed footwear like slip-ons. Your feet will thank you later.
  • The result of lengthy periods of inactivity, de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is a blood clotting condition that can affect some passengers during long-haul flights. But the great news is there are numerous ways to reduce the risk of developing it. Stay well hydrated, wander around the cabin as much as possible and wear compression tights or socks.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Piasa?
The answer is simple — be prepared. We've compiled some handy tips and tricks for an easy trip through airport security. Look out Piasa, here you come:

  • Have your passport and boarding pass within easy reach. They're the first items you'll be asked for by airport security.
  • Your jacket, belt, keys and other items in your pocket, like coins, will need to go on a tray through the X-ray machine. Make your life easier by removing them as it gets closer to your turn.
  • All your electronics, including your phone and tablet, are also required to be separately scanned.
  • Any gels or liquids, such as shampoo or hairspray, that you want to take on board need to be in containers no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ters). Also, everything must fit inside a quart-size (one liter), clear zip-lock bag.
  • Choosing your footwear wisely can save you valuable minutes. Boots and heavy shoes are often required to be removed and X-rayed separately. Slip-on shoes usually aren't.
  • Sharp or pointed items are prohibited in the cabin. They'll be seized at security, so pack them safely away in your checked baggage.
